Birnamwood Waterworks: frequently asked questions
Is Birnamwood Waterworks's water safe to drink?
Birnamwood Waterworks is an active community water system regulated under the Safe Drinking Water Act, overseen by the WI state drinking water program. EPA SDWA violation and enforcement records for this system are being added to AquaCensus from EPA ECHO; consult EPA ECHO or your annual Consumer Confidence Report for its current compliance status.
Who runs Birnamwood Waterworks?
Birnamwood Waterworks (PWSID WI4590449) is a local government-owned community water system, regulated by the WI state drinking water program.
How many people does Birnamwood Waterworks serve?
Birnamwood Waterworks reports serving 832 people through 308 service connections in Shawano County, Wisconsin.
Where does Birnamwood Waterworks get its water?
EPA SDWIS lists this system's primary water source as groundwater.
